Our Design Process

    • An Initial client briefing (preferably in person) to discuss your vision, inspiration, design ideas, budget, the site, the process and timeframes.

    • A letter of engagement outlining our proposed fees along with an agreement for architectural services is then drawn up for your approval. Once approval is received, we begin the design stages.

    • We will inspect your site and access conditions, constraints and advantages.

    • Investigate and analyse site information and District Plan requirements.

    • Undertake a site measure for existing houses and model in our 3D drawing package (ArchiCAD).

    • An initial concept will be drawn up and presented, based on the your brief and site limitations and advantages.

    • Any separate consultants will be identified which may be required for the project and we will facilitate their appointment. They could include: Geotech Engineer, Surveyor, Resource Consent Planner, Structural Engineer, Fire Engineer.

    • If necessary, we will model the site based on a topographic survey.

    • Prepare a Preliminary Design based off the agreed concept with drawings showing site plan, floor plan, elevations, sections and 3D views.

    • Prepare an outline specification of the proposed materials.

    • At this point it may be prudent to seek an independent Quantity Surveyor to provide a preliminary estimate of cost based on this Preliminary Design to ensure the estimated construction costs fit within your budget. We can facilitate this.

    • We will also determine the need for a Resource Consent and prepare drawings to be included in the application if necessary. We would facilitate a Resource Consent Planner to undertake the consent application on your behalf.

    • Once you are happy with the Preliminary Design it will be refined further and incorporate design input from other consultants.

    • The specifications will be updated including proposed materials and finishes.

    • We will also consult with territorial authorities on any building specific issues.

    • Drawings are finalised.

    • The specification of materials and finishes is also finalised.

    • The documentation for the Building Consent application is prepared and lodged.

    • We will response to any Requests for Further Information on your behalf from the local council regarding the application.

    • If the design project is to be tendered, we will prepare the contract documents and oversee the procurement process which includes assessing suitable contractors.

    • Manage the tendering process on your behalf.

    • Coordinate the signing of contractual documents between yourselves and the selected contractor.

    • During the build, we will work as a project manager liaising between yourselves, the builder and other sub-contractors on site.

    • Regularly visit site during construction to observe progress and compliance.

    • Answer any project queries.

    • Process variations as required.

    • Provide any necessary supplementary documentation.

    • Assess and certify any progress payments.

    • Complete the Practical Certification components.

    • Assess any defects and issue certification.

    • Review any warranties.

  • We can also assist with:

    Feasibility Studies – an exploration and analysis of a proposed project to determine its viability and merits.

    Site suitability – happy to discuss your design ideas and inspiration in line with a particular site to access its suitability pre-purchase.

Having the opportunity to design a new home or alter an existing home is an exciting but daunting task. We are here to guide you through the process, and work with you to achieve a design which meets your needs and wants and makes the most of your site and outlook.

These are the usual steps in the design process, which we work methodically through. Each project is different though and some projects will have all the steps and others only selected steps.
